## v2.8.0 — Consent banner rollout

The Lanternleaf consent banner is now enabled for 100% of traffic across all regions. This release includes the regional policy matrix, the preference-center link in the footer, and persistence of consent state across subdomains. Known issue: the banner briefly flashes on cached pages; a fix is scheduled for v2.8.1. No further action is needed from regional teams. Final rollout approval for this release was given by the person named below.

account owner for fajep-yagef: Kasix Eliiel

The garage occupancy feed for the Brindlewood campus arrives over a message queue every thirty seconds, one record per level, published by the Stallgrid edge boxes. Counts can briefly go negative when a sensor double-fires on exit; the ingest job clamps these to zero and flags the interval. If the feed stalls for more than five minutes, the dashboard falls back to the last known snapshot. Sensor mappings, queue names, and the replay procedure are documented on the internal page below.

runbook for tahog-kadug: https://gitlab.qirvanworks.corp/projects/pages/view/b139298aed28

- [ ] Before the Quillhaven key ceremony kicks off, run the snapshot tests for the Fernwheel UI kit one last time. If any component snapshots changed, don't just hit update — ping whoever touched the button styles last sprint. We freeze the repo once keys are cut, so stale snapshots become everyone's headache. Once the suite is green, grab the vault recovery material. The passphrase you'll need is below.

recovery phrase for fawif-tajeg: norael-aldmir-casir-brivan-ulaion

Q: Why does Graphlet show my package with no edges?

A: Graphlet, our dependency graph visualizer, only indexes manifests after a successful build on the Torvane pipeline. If your package is new or its last build failed, edges won't render. Trigger a build, wait ten minutes, refresh. Circular dependencies render in red; those need fixing, not re-indexing. Full troubleshooting steps for new team members are on the page below.

dashboard of bafof-hafog = https://confluence.lumiclabs.internal/display/browse/display/6a09a20a